FAILURE IS A STEPPING
STONE TO SUCCESS
Thomas Edison once said, "Show me a thoroughly satisfied man and I will show you a failure." These words hold a profound truth: true success is not found in complacency but in the relentless pursuit of our aspirations. Success does not come knocking at our door; instead, we must actively desire it and be willing to embark on the journey.
However, the path to success is rarely a smooth one. Along the way, we
encounter failures and setbacks that may seem disheartening. But it is in our
ability to navigate through these challenges and manage failure that we
ultimately find success.
Take the example of Edison himself. His remarkable achievements did not
come without numerous disappointments and setbacks. Similarly, Henry Ford,
renowned for his success in the automotive industry, encountered years of
obstacles before his dream of the famous Model T car was realized. These
stories of triumph amid adversity are endless. What sets these great achievers
apart is their unwavering belief that failure is not the end of the road.
In fact, successful individuals view failure as a stepping stone to
success. They sing songs of perseverance and resilience in the face of defeat.
As Napoleon Hill wisely noted, "Before success comes in any man's life, he
is sure to meet temporary defeats and perhaps some failures." This truth
is both evident and understandable.
Success lies just beyond the point where defeat threatens to overpower
us. It requires that extra step of faith, that unwavering determination to push
through and rise above our failures. If others have achieved success despite
encountering setbacks, then we too can embrace this principle and forge our own
path to greatness.
So, remember that failure is not an end but a new beginning in earnest.
Embrace each setback as an opportunity to learn and grow. Let resilience and
perseverance be your guiding lights on the road to success. With each failure,
you are one step closer to achieving your dreams. Let failure fuel your
determination, and success will be within your grasp.
